Summary

When faced with overwhelming hardship, what we believe makes all the difference.

At age twenty-six, Anne Reeder Heck was attacked by a stranger and brutally raped. Years later, still seeking to heal the remnants of this trauma, Anne stands alone in her living room one winter day and claims her desired belief aloud: “This is my year of strength.” Her clear intention results in a phone call; her rapist has been identified—fourteen years after the crime.

Offering all the gripping and uplifting details of a story that sparked national interest—Heck appeared on the front page of The Washington Post and was interviewed by Diane Sawyer on Good Morning America—A Fierce Belief in Miracles lights the way for those seeking to heal from life’s traumas by demonstrating the importance of clear intention and trusting inner guidance, and the transformative power of forgiveness.

Author Biography

Anne Heck is a speaker, healer, mentor, and artist devoted to inspiring and guiding women to trust themselves, open to their intuitive guidance, and experience the magic of life through ceremony, positive intention, and a creative and curious spirit. Anne graduated with honors from Oberlin College with a degree in chemistry. She lives in the beautiful Blue Ridge Mountains of North Carolina with her husband of twenty-six years and her sweet retriever pup. She can often be found exploring the trails in Pisgah Forest with her dog or meditatively turning her pedals on the Blue Ridge Parkway. When she’s not outdoors, Anne is passionately speaking, leading workshops, mentoring, or making art.
